Olivia wants to find out whether a substance will fluoresce. She says she should put it in a microwave oven. Do you agree with her? Why or why not?

I do not agree with Olivia's method of testing for fluorescence by putting a substance in a microwave oven. Here are a few reasons why this approach is not advisable:

1. **Microwave Functionality**: Microwaves heat substances by exciting water molecules and other polar molecules through electromagnetic radiation. This process does not provide a means to observe or induce fluorescence in a substance, which generally requires excitation by ultraviolet (UV) light or other sources that can promote electrons to higher energy levels.

2. **Safety Concerns**: Microwaving substances that are not intended to be heated in a microwave can be dangerous. Certain materials may release toxic fumes, catch fire, or cause the microwave to malfunction.

3. **Fluorescence Testing**: To properly test for fluorescence, a more suitable method would be to expose the substance to a UV light source. Fluorescent materials absorb UV light and re-emit it at a longer wavelength (typically visible light), which can be easily observed.

In summary, the proper approach to determine if a substance fluoresces would involve using appropriate light sources and safe testing methods rather than a microwave oven.
